2024 Հեղինակ: Lynn Donovan | [email protected]. Վերջին փոփոխված: 2023-12-15 23:48
Այն ստատիկ հիմնաբառ Java-ում է օգտագործված հիմնականում հիշողության կառավարման համար: Դա է օգտագործված փոփոխականներով, մեթոդներով, բլոկներով և ներդիր դասերով: Դա է հիմնաբառ այն է օգտագործված կիսել տվյալ դասի նույն փոփոխականը կամ մեթոդը: Սա օգտագործված հաստատուն փոփոխականի կամ մեթոդի համար, որը նույնն է դասի յուրաքանչյուր օրինակի համար:
Նաև իմանալ, թե որն է օրինակով ստատիկ հիմնաբառը:
Երբ մեթոդը հայտարարվում է ստատիկ հիմնաբառ , այն հայտնի է որպես ստատիկ մեթոդ. Առավել տարածված օրինակ ա ստատիկ մեթոդը main() մեթոդն է: Ինչպես քննարկվեց վերևում, Any ստատիկ անդամին կարելի է մուտք գործել նախքան իր դասի օբյեկտների ստեղծումը և առանց որևէ օբյեկտի հղումների: Նրանք կարող են միայն ուղղակիորեն մուտք գործել ստատիկ տվյալները։
Նաև կարո՞ղ ենք Java-ում դասի հետ ստատիկ հիմնաբառ օգտագործել: Ստատիկ հիմնաբառը կարող է լինել օգտագործված հետ դաս , փոփոխական, մեթոդ և բլոկ: Ստատիկ անդամները պատկանում են դաս կոնկրետ օրինակի փոխարեն, սա նշանակում է, եթե դուք անդամ եք դառնում ստատիկ , դու կարող է մուտք գործել այն առանց օբյեկտի:
Նաև հարցրեց, թե ինչ է նշանակում ստատիկը Java-ում:
Պատասխանել. Այն ստատիկ հիմնաբառը նշանակում է, որ անդամ փոփոխականին կամ մեթոդին կարելի է մուտք գործել՝ առանց պահանջելու այն դասի օրինակը, որին այն պատկանում է: Պարզ ասած, դա նշանակում է որ դուք կարող եք անվանել մեթոդ, նույնիսկ եթե դուք երբեք չեք ստեղծել այն օբյեկտը, որին այն պատկանում է:
Ո՞րն է ստատիկի օգտագործումը:
Java-ում, ստատիկ հիմնաբառը հիմնականում օգտագործվում է հիշողության կառավարման համար: Այն կարող է օգտագործվել փոփոխականների, մեթոդների, բլոկների և ներդիր դասերի հետ: Դա հիմնաբառ է, որն օգտագործվում է տվյալ դասի նույն փոփոխականը կամ մեթոդը կիսելու համար: Հիմնականում, ստատիկ օգտագործվում է հաստատուն փոփոխականի կամ մեթոդի համար, որը նույնն է դասի յուրաքանչյուր օրինակի համար:
Խորհուրդ ենք տալիս:
Ի՞նչ է անում ֆունկցիան ստատիկ դարձնելը:
C-ում ստատիկ ֆունկցիան տեսանելի չէ իր թարգմանության միավորից դուրս, որն այն օբյեկտի ֆայլն է, որի մեջ կազմվում է: Այլ կերպ ասած, ֆունկցիան ստատիկ դարձնելը սահմանափակում է դրա շրջանակը: Դուք կարող եք ստատիկ ֆունկցիայի մասին պատկերացնել որպես «մասնավոր» իր *-ի համար: c ֆայլ (չնայած դա խիստ ճիշտ չէ)
Ի՞նչ է ստատիկ մեթոդ Java-ն:
Java-ում Static Method-ը պատկանում է դասին և ոչ թե դրա օրինակներին: Ստատիկ մեթոդը կարող է մուտք գործել միայն դասի ստատիկ փոփոխականներ և կանչել դասի միայն ստատիկ մեթոդներ: Սովորաբար, ստատիկ մեթոդները օգտակար մեթոդներ են, որոնք մենք ցանկանում ենք ցուցադրել այլ դասերի կողմից օգտագործելու համար՝ առանց օրինակ ստեղծելու անհրաժեշտության:
Ինչպե՞ս եք ծաղրում ստատիկ դասը:
Ստեղծեք ինտերֆեյս DriverManager-ի համար, ծաղրեք այս ինտերֆեյսը, ներարկեք այն ինչ-որ կախվածության ներարկման միջոցով և ստուգեք այդ ծաղրի վրա: Դիտարկում. Երբ ստատիկ էության մեջ ստատիկ մեթոդ եք կանչում, դուք պետք է փոխեք դասը @PrepareForTest-ում: այնուհետև դուք պետք է պատրաստեք այն դասը, որտեղ այս կոդը գտնվում է
Ինչ է Java Swing-ը օրինակով:
Javax. swing փաթեթը տրամադրում է դասեր java swing API-ի համար, ինչպիսիք են JButton, JTextField, JTextArea, JRadioButton, JCheckbox, JMenu, JColorChooser և այլն: Բաղադրիչների դասի սովորաբար օգտագործվող մեթոդները: Մեթոդի նկարագրություն public void setSize (int width,int height) սահմանում է բաղադրիչի չափը
Ո՞րն է սուպեր հիմնաբառի օգտագործումը:
Java super Keyword super-ի օգտագործումը կարող է օգտագործվել անմիջական ծնող դասի օրինակի փոփոխականին անդրադառնալու համար: super-ը կարող է օգտագործվել անմիջական ծնող դասի մեթոդը կանչելու համար: super()-ը կարող է օգտագործվել անմիջական ծնող դասի կոնստրուկտորին կանչելու համար